Welcome aboard! Before you write your first Larkspur plugin, please read the stale-cache postmortem from last spring. Short version: our tile renderer kept serving week-old data because a plugin overrode the TTL header and nobody noticed until a customer demo went sideways. The fix added a hard cap on plugin-set TTLs plus a cache-bust hook you're expected to call on schema changes. It's a quick read and will save you from repeating the same mistake. The full writeup lives here.

runbook for badug-kadup: https://confluence.zemvarlabs.internal/projects/browse/display/projects/bd1b

**Q: How does pagination work in the Fennel public REST API?**

A: All list endpoints use cursor-based pagination. Responses include a `next_cursor` token, which clients pass back to fetch the following page. Page size defaults to 50 and caps at 200. Note that cursors expire after 15 minutes, so long-running exports should checkpoint frequently. Before each release, confirm the pagination contract tests pass, since downstream partners like Orvane depend on them. The full spec is documented internally here:

wiki page, fahif-bawep: https://jira.tolvaqsys.internal/browse/projects/projects/67caf315

### v3.2.0 — Renamed setting

Keyspindle no longer reads `KS_ROTATE_TOKEN`; it was renamed for consistency with the plugin API. Plugins targeting 3.2+ must use the new name or rotation hooks will not fire. The old name is ignored silently — no deprecation warning is emitted. Update your `.env` before upgrading. Keep `KS_PLUGIN_DIR` and `KS_LOG_LEVEL` as-is. Immediately after those entries, add the renamed token line with your existing value.

secret setting of kawif-kajef: COURIER_KEY3=d2b

Break-glass is only justified when the registry's signing service is unreachable and a production validator must be hot-patched. Before proceeding, page the on-call steward and record your justification in the incident log; access is audited and reviewed at the next eng sync. Once approved, open the sealed credentials store from the registry host. Unsealing it requires the recovery passphrase, which appears directly below this paragraph.

vault phrase of bagaf-kajeg = jorath-feniel-briir-siliel-ralix